Team development creates a captivating atmosphere by encouraging co-operation, teamwork, interdependence and by building trust among team members. If you see how well your team works, an evaluation will allow you to set markers for future reference. But if a team faces internal obstacles, a detailed evaluation of all the team processes becomes even more critical. There are numerous methods you can use to evaluate your team’s processes, but the most simple and effective include benchmarking, ongoing team discussions, and project debriefings. Another important factor in looking for an ideal developer is their ability to learn constantly.
Team development requires a view of the group as a whole rather than its parts. There are times when the wrong individual is put into a group and depending on the reasons why it can create issues. For example, team members who are not a good fit may cause the team to stay in the storming phase. In this stage, the team completes the majority of the work required to finish the project. They perform at peak capacity because they have learned to identify and use each other’s strengths to complete the goal. Bruce Tuckman created the stages of a team in a paper he published in 1965.
And generally, it’s always nice to work with a team that, well, doesn’t mess up. Here’s the thing, the line between certain stages can get blurred since team members evolve at different times. While https://globalcloudteam.com/ originally things had been going according to plan, roadblocks crop up during this stage. You recognize that your team is new, and want them to feel supported, motivated and psychologically safe.
Development Team Responsibilities: Maintaining Effectiveness
While the goals of the team become clearer, the specifics of how to achieve those goals are still unclear. The FiveStages of Team Development were developed by psychologist Bruce Tuckman in 1965. These five stages advance as a team works together, but especially when a team brings awareness to their dynamic. You will also find that imposing goals on people doesn’t work nearly as well as having them tell you as to what goals they will strive for. Too often they end up in being too unrealistic, too vague, impossible to measure, or just stretching into eternity without any deadline. So recognizing and publicly acknowledging accomplishments also become important.
Allow extra time to review the ideas the team shares and to answer questions. At the end of the project, set up an online meeting where team members come together to discuss the entire project, from the successes to the frustrations. Ask them to prepare examples beforehand outlining what worked and what didn’t, and then give each person five minutes to share their thoughts. Document the comments so that it’s easy to see which trends emerge and what changes need to be made going forward. Additionally, the team members are helping each other to grow and develop their skills.
Define A Mission And Shared Goals
Members of the team decide on a task they want to work on and are usually highly positive about it. This stage also takes time since everyone on the team still has to get to know each other. Kubernetes clusters have distributed services that support dynamic software.
- Team members have to work their way through becoming coworkers that work in their full capacity from entire strangers.
- Once this occurs, it can be hard for the team to move out of these negative behaviors to reach the norming phase.
- Take a closer look at people who have worked for at least 5 years in the domain in question, those who have been employed by large- or medium-sized companies who value a good workplace culture.
- His original article was published with only four stages in team development, but later he added a fifth.
- Bring the team together on a regular basis to work on joint projects and thus get to know each other better.
Individual members might feel all of these things at the same time, or may cycle through feelings of loss followed by feelings of satisfaction. Given these conflicting feelings, individual and team morale may rise or fall throughout the ending stage. It is highly likely that at any given moment individuals on the team will be experiencing different emotions about the team’s ending. The most commonly used framework for a team’s stages of development was developed in the mid-1960s by Bruce W. Tuckman. As a leader of a business organization, you need to define a vision, common goals, and a clear strategy that motivates high engagement and commitment within your team.
However, software engineering best practices help you work more efficiently and secure projects, making it less likely to introduce bugs that hackers could exploit. Also, you can keep pace with modern trends and ensure relevance in a thriving digital landscape, even in the long run. We use Agile software development with DevOps acceleration, to improve the software delivery process and encourage reliable releases that bring exceptional end-user experience. Smarter IT Outsourcing Outsource time consuming and critical software componentsSmarter IT Outsourcing Achieve business goals faster by outsourcing critical software components. Optimize the quality and cost-effectiveness of IT operations. With 12 years in software development, Simform can take over any digital product engineering tasks you want to outsource.
Team Development: Forming Storming Norming And Performing
If you need to make test cases, then you’ll have to call for a QA to backup the project. Meanwhile, if you’re working with a project from scratch, usually two backend and one frontend developer, one QA, and one project manager should be enough. The thing is, it’s not enough to lock them in a room and give them a deadline. An efficient team isn’t just about professionalism; it’s also about how the team members interact. Only a truly efficient team can deal with the workload faster and be more productive.
China’s Zhou Guanyu signs Alfa Romeo contract extension, keeps F1 seat in 2023 – South China Morning Post
China’s Zhou Guanyu signs Alfa Romeo contract extension, keeps F1 seat in 2023.
Posted: Tue, 27 Sep 2022 10:04:46 GMT [source]
These feelings of excitement are sometimes mixed with curiosity and anxiety as well. Even though these students might not be conversant with the things to do in their new classes, they all believe they would complete it successfully. About 57 years ago, a behavioral psychologist named Bruce Wayne Tuckman conducted research and came up with four phases that every healthy team would need to pass through.
Stages Of Team Development
Don’t leave team conflict unchecked, but remember that a little friction can be a good thing – it might reveal inefficiencies for the group to fix together and, ultimately, lead to innovation. Schedule regular reviews of where your team is at, and adjust your behavior and leadership approach accordingly. Each of these programs is customized to kick start your team’s journey from pleasantries to planning by highlighting each person’s strengths and bringing out their personalities.
Finally, share the project roadmap so the team can see the starting point, the proposed check-in points, and the end goal. This gives them insight into the bigger goal but also breaks down the timeline into smaller increments. They are joined by the project sponsor and some other executives who are extremely pleased with the end result.
Members feel satisfied with their progress and are confident in their abilities. Pushing a team to its full potential isn’t as easy and simple. Team members have to work their way through becoming coworkers that work in their full capacity from entire strangers.
Storming To Norming
This may take some time, as people get to know their new colleagues and one another’s ways of working. This is the point where the project comes to an end and the team separates and goes their separate ways. Some team members may find this hard because they liked the routine of the group, have made close friendships or if the future, after leaving this team, looks bleak and unpromising. Use personality tests, such as the ones outlined in the article, to aid the understanding of each others personality and work styles.
Members often have high positive expectations for the team experience. At the same time, they may also feel some anxiety, wondering how they will fit in to the team and if their performance will measure up. Team effectiveness is enhanced by a team’s commitment to reflection and on-going evaluation. In addition to evaluating accomplishments in terms of forming team development meeting specific goals, for teams to be high-performing it is essential for them to understand their development as a team. On top of it, an inexperienced developer will basically learn at your expense and generate little to no value. At the same time, they will take the place of a person who could have moved your project forward in leaps and bounds.
Team leadership Support managers with the tools and resources they need to lead hybrid & remote teams. The manager, as the team sponsor, must understand how to support the team at each stage for it to succeed. Tuckman’s stages of group development and how this model can help your team develop and become effective. So, if you still have not adopted software engineering best practices, it is high time to choose the relevant ones for your business.
It might not be possible to plan an in-person meet-up, especially if your projects have short turnaround times. Create an agenda and establish a document to track ideas and comments during the meeting. Share a link to these meeting notes afterwards so that everyone has access and can review it later. Organize the agenda so that each team member has five to ten minutes to talk through their insights and ideas.
This is demonstrated through high morale, productivity and engagement. It’s an ideal state for any manager to witness their team’s growth and ask reflective questions. With a thoughtful look at each stage of team development, you can solve problems before they derail the team. You cannot treat a team the same at each stage of its development because the stages dictate different support actions. These support actions, taken at the right time, will allow your teams to successfully meet their challenges.
Members of the team are not easily swayed by side distractions but are focused, concentrated, and dedicated. The team is very active at this stage and mainly concentrated on achieving its purpose of formation. To do this, encourage your team members to engage in constant communication with one another. This way, the team’s progress will be visible to the team members. Instead, they concentrate on the negative feelings they have towards each other and the team at large.
Pay Attention To The Psychological Syncing Of Dedicated Development Teams
In fact, a big secret of how to manage a software development team may be related to a clever mix of people’s differences and encouraging skilled professionals by creating equal career opportunities. Before we go any further, let’s do a quick turn to what makes up a really effective team. Consider these five steps if you want to create a truly successful development team that will help you achieve your goal. When your team has grown through the stages of team development they establish a state of “flow”. This means they understand how to work together in a cohesive way that helps them reach their goals. The forming stage is all about getting to know everyone on the team.
And this would lead to an increase in team’s productivity and performance. Since the team is rarely disturbed with conflicts and disagreements, every member of the team can easily work together to achieve the team’s goals. And the team is more focused on achieving its goals and objectives. Some of them might even start to question the team’s goals and objectives. As the team leader, you can organize an introduction event in which the only goal of the event would be for team members to get familiar with each other.